Pensioen

“Pensioen” is a Dutch term that translates to “pension” in English. It refers to a retirement plan or fund that provides financial support to individuals after they have ceased working, typically due to age. A pensioen may be composed of various components, including contributions made by the employer, employee, or both during the employee’s working life. Upon retirement, the accumulated funds are disbursed to the individual, usually in the form of regular payments, to help sustain their standard of living. Pensioenen can be structured in different ways, including defined benefit plans, which guarantee a specific payout upon retirement, and defined contribution plans, where the payout amount depends on the contributions made and investment performance. The concept of pensioen is significant in providing financial security for individuals in their later years.
